#cc57cf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cc57cf is composed of 80% red, 34.1%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.4% cyan, 58%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 298.5 degrees, a saturation of 55.6% and a lightness of 57.6%. #cc57cf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ffaeff with #99009f.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#cc57cf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cc57cf has RGB values of R:204, G:87, B:207 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0.58,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 13391823.
